MAITLAND, Fla. – Lake Lily Park was shut down and the Maitland Farmers Market was evacuated Sunday morning after the body of a man was found in Lake Lily, police said.
Maitland police on Thursday identified the body as Theodore Capretta, 71, of Maitland.
His cause of death remains under investigation, police said.
Maitland police said vendors were setting up for the farmers market around 9:30 a.m. Sunday when they noticed a strong stench coming from the shores of the lake near the intersection of North Orlando and Maitland avenues. Park officials then called police.
The park and the farmers market were evacuated once Maitland police found the body, officers said.
